Kilerama (Fatehpur Kilerama) in context

With 747 people at the 2011 Census, Kilerama (Fatehpur Kilerama) was the 549th most populous of its district's 1072 villages, below the district average of 991.

Literacy stood at 72.52%, 5.3 points above the district's rural average of 67.27%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 800, 123 below the rural national 923.

62.0% of the population were recorded as workers, 14.6 points above the district's rural rate.
